  • As a first step to apply PVAm (polyvinylamine) on packaging paper by surface treatment, three types of linerboards were impregnated with PVAm solution. The effect of PVAm pick-up on strength properties of linerboard was investigated. The pick-up of PVAm was controlled by varying concentration of PVAm solution. It was found that dry tensile strength, tensile energy absorption, burst strength and compressive strength of linerboard were increased by applying PVAm. In addition, wet tensile strength was significantly improved with increasing PVAm pick-up. However, folding endurance was found to be decreased with increasing PVAm pick-up.

  • The stability and performance (peel strength) of the acrylic copolymer and various modified rosin systems were investigated. The peel strength was measured over a wide range of scaling rates, and the influence of the viscoelasticity of the PSA(pressure sensitive adhesive) was considered. In the case of miscible systems, the peak of peel strength (PSA performance) over wide peel rates was changed and modified systematically with increasing glass transition temperature of the blends. The peak of the peel strength for blended systems shifts toward the lower rate side as glass transition temperature ($T_g$) of the blend increased. The influence of esterification of the rosin on performance and stability against deterioration was greatly modified by blending with rosin of glycerol ester and rosin pentaerythritol ester. The failure mode of the blend varies with the combination with acrylic copolymer and modified rosin, and cohesive failure was found at a lower peel rate while interfacial failure was found at a high peel rate. A few systems where a single Tg could be measured, despite the fact that two phases were observed microscopically, were detected.

  • The base paper of corrugated board is mainly produced from Korean old corrugated container (KOCC), and thus the recycling rate of KOCC is very high. However, there is a problem that the pulp quality is very low while the recycling rate of OCC is high. The fines content in KOCC, the main source of the corrugated board, amounts to nearly the half of the total stock, and its formation increases as recycling process repeats due to the hornification of fiber. There have been attempts to improve the drainage property of OCC by increasing the headbox concentration of the paper machine or by applying drainage-promoting polymer additives. However, these conventional methods have problems of weakened paper strength and lowered converting fitness caused by paper formation hindrance. The strength of linerboard could not be increased in case KOCC is used, because hornified OCC pulp can-not be sufficiently refined due to the lowered drainage property caused by fines formation. We studied about a new technique consisting of froth-flotation for fractionating pulp stock into a long fiber portion and fines fraction. This study will be developed in order to enhance the drainage and strength properties of a recycled OCC pulp by selective treatment of flocculant on fractionated OCC Fines.

  • This paper presents a modular structure design of analog Hopfield neural network. Each multiplier consists of four MOS transistors which are connected to an op-amp at the front end of a neuron. A pair of MOS transistor is used in order to maintain linear operation of the synapse and can produce positive or negative synaptic weight. This architecture can be expandable to any size neural network by forming tree structure. By altering the connections, other nework paradigms can also be implemented using this basic modules. The stength of this approach is the expandability and the general applicability. The layout design of a four-neuron fully connected feedback neural network is presented and is simulated using SPICE. The network shows correct retrival of distorted patterns.

  • Recently many firms are introducing the cellular manufacturing system(CMS) as a means of achieving manufacturing efficiencies. However, most of the research on CMS was mainly for determining the cell formation problems. Since the goal of the CMS is not only a increase production efficiencies, but also to enhance the competitive stength of a firm, it would be reasonable to assume CMS as a business reengineering module rather than an independent technique. The purpose of this study is to align the CMS with reengineering, to present an integrated methodology for constructing the CMS, and to apply the CMS to a firm and verify it. The paper concludes with a brief description of the lessons learend by the CMS project and the limitations of the research are described.

  • This paper presents an accelerated-curing method by the war water method and discusses how these methods can be adapted for regular quality control and quality assurance of concret. Accelerated strength test data can be used for estimating the furture stength, e.g. the 28-day strength. An accelerated-curing method to predict the 28-day strength of concrete from 1-day warm water-cured test results was evaluated in the laboratory and the field. For these evaluations test are performed for 1845 standard specimens from 123 different batches of concrete. The results of this study the equation applicable universally with resonable accuracy are presented for estimating the potential strength of concrete by the warm water-curing method.

  • Recently the use of ceramic materals has been greatly increased in the industries. But machining of the ceramics is quite unproductive because of their high stength,high hardness,and brittleness. The efficiency of the grinding operation of ceramics depends on the preparation of diamond grinding wheel, i.e.,truning and dressing. This paper describes some experimental results on the dressing conditions of diamond grinding wheel. The dressing performance is evaluated by the magnitude of normal grinding force. The better dressed wheels result in the lower normal grinding forces. The dressing performances of copper plate and aluminum oxide dressing stick are compared. The optimum dressing conditions including the grit size of dressing sticks, the depth of the dressing operation, and the dressing speed qre determined.

  • In this paper, fatigue crack propagation behaviors were investigated experimentally for the materials, carbon steel forgings (SF45A, SF50A, SF60A) which are used in the marine propeller shaft. The results obtained are as follows: The number of cycles required to grow crack length 1.30mm from microcrack initiation was about 60% of the total fatigue life. Fatigue crack propagation rate was expressed by the equation d(2a)/dN_B 2a/$N_f$ and the result was agreed well with the experimented data. And the equation d(2a)/dN=$C{\sigma}_a^m(2a)^n$ was evaluated also. Obtained material property m and n are 3~5 and 1-1.5 respectably, and the result was reasonably agreed to the data obtained from experiments.

  • In this paper, we have investigated deformation of cup for EFI detonator in high velocity impact test. The experimental result shows that STS cup deformed 0.170 mm with the bulged shape. The numerical simulation result with static/dynamic material properties of SUS304 shows 0.166 mm of deformation. The main parameters to decrease the deformation of cup are stength, thickness and density of cup. The initial condition of SUS304 cup was strength of 215 MPa and thickness of 0.12 mm. As strength increases to 500 MPa, deformation of cup converges to 0 mm, and as thickness increases to 0.18 mm, deformation of cup converges to 0 mm. If the density of cup decreases from 8 to 2.7 g/cc, the deformation of cup decreases to 0.141 mm.

  • The design of tall buildings has recently provided many challenges to structural engineers. One such challenge is to minimise the cross-sectional dimensions of columns to ensure greater floor space in a building is attainable. This has both an economic and aesthetics benefit in buildings, which require structural engineering solutions. The use of high strength steel in tall buildings has the ability to achieve these benefits as the material provides a higher strength to cross-section ratio. However as the strength of the steel is increased the buckling characteristics become more dominant with slenderness limits for both local and global buckling becoming more significant. To arrest the problems associated with buckling of high strength steel, concrete filling and encasement can be utilised as it has the affect of changing the buckling mode, which increases the strength and stiffness of the member. This paper describes an experimental program undertaken for both encased and concrete filled composite columns, which were designed to be stocky in nature and thus fail by strength alone. The columns were designed to consider the strength in axial compression and were fabricated from high strength steel plate. In addition to the encased and concrete filled columns, unencased columns and hollow columns were also fabricated and tested to act as calibration specimens. A model for the axial strength was suggested and this is shown to compare well with the test results. Finally aspects of further research are addressed in this paper which include considering the effects of slender columns which may fail by global instabilities.
